Job Responsibilities

  • Provide comprehensive care to laboring and postpartum patients
  • Monitor fetal heart rates and maternal vital signs
  • Assist with vaginal deliveries and cesarean sections
  • Collaborate with OB/GYNs, midwives, and neonatal teams
  • Educate patients and families on childbirth and newborn care
  • Respond to obstetric emergencies with critical thinking and precision

Requirements

  • Experience: Minimum 2 years of Labor & Delivery experience
  • License: Active RN license (required at submission)
  • Education: BSN not required

Required Certifications

  • ACLS
  • BLS (AHA)
  • NRP (Neonatal Resuscitation Program)
  • AWHONN Advanced Fetal Monitoring (AFM)
  • COVID-19 Vaccination
